首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在文本字段中检测英文字符?

在文本字段中检测英文字符的常见方法是使用正则表达式。正则表达式是一种描述字符串模式的方法,可以用于匹配、查找和替换文本。

以下是一个示例的正则表达式,可以用于检测文本字段中是否包含英文字符:

代码语言:txt
复制
[a-zA-Z]

该正则表达式使用了字符类(character class)来匹配所有的英文字母。其中,a-z表示小写字母,A-Z表示大写字母。如果文本字段中包含任何英文字母,该正则表达式都会匹配成功。

除了使用正则表达式,还可以考虑使用编程语言的字符串处理函数。不同编程语言提供的函数可能会有所不同,但通常都会提供类似于containsindexOf等函数来检测字符串中是否包含指定的子串。因此,可以使用这些函数来检测字符串中是否包含英文字符。

以下是使用Python语言的示例代码,演示如何使用字符串处理函数来检测英文字符:

代码语言:txt
复制
def detect_english_chars(text):
    for char in text:
        if char.isalpha() and char.isascii():
            return True
    return False

text_field = "Hello, 你好!"
if detect_english_chars(text_field):
    print("The text field contains English characters.")
else:
    print("The text field does not contain English characters.")

这段代码通过遍历字符串中的每个字符,利用Python字符串的isalpha()isascii()方法判断字符是否为英文字母和ASCII字符。如果找到了一个英文字符,就认为文本字段中包含英文字符。

推荐的腾讯云相关产品:无

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券